Shirakawa, Fukushima

Shirakawa (白河市; -shi) is a city located in Fukushima, Japan. As of 2003, the city has an estimated population of 48,297 and the density of 410.44 persons per km. The total area is 117.67 km. The city was founded on April 1, 1949. Shirakawa has schools, middle schools, high schools, banks, a post office, and parks. Shirakawa is accessed by a nearby expressway, the Tohoku Expressway and routes 289 and 294.
